Hmmmm....salvage title and only mod being a BOV.
I would pass.
Plus, unless you are paying straight up cash, not many financial institutions will do a car loan on a salvage title (not sure about insurance).

If he did the interior restoration after the theft recovery, ask for records/receipts. Also carfax check it of course....even though a theft recovery may not show up on the report depending on the jurisdiction (i.e. some PD's are lazy...cough SFPD cough).
